Pair of Antique Iron Wagon Wheels – 20" Diameter, 8 Spokes Each
This pair of antique iron wagon wheels offers a classic example of early utilitarian craftsmanship. Each wheel measures approximately 20 inches in diameter and features 8 sturdy iron spokes radiating from a solid central hub to a 1¾-inch wide rim. Likely dating from the early to mid-20th century, these wheels were possibly part of a farm cart, small utility wagon, or industrial equipment.
Constructed from solid iron, both wheels display surface rust and a naturally aged patina, with visible oxidation enhancing their vintage aesthetic. Together weighing approximately 15 pounds, they make excellent candidates for rustic décor, repurposed furniture bases, or garden and landscape accents. A Campbell’s soup can is shown for scale, emphasizing their compact but striking presence.
Condition:
In good condition overall, with age-appropriate wear, oxidation, and surface rust consistent with long-term outdoor use. Structurally sound with no cracks or major deformations. Authentic patina contributes to their vintage appeal.
